阅读指南设计软件的技术需求
价格 双方协商
地区: 黑龙江省 哈尔滨市 松北区
需求方: 黑龙***公司
行业领域
电子信息技术
需求背景
针对当前数字图书市场、产业、文本格式标准化未统一的现状,提出了一个可行的数字图书解析、阅读的解决方案,以软件作为突破口,尽可能克服当前电子书格式多样化的局面,而这一过程对使用者是透明的,使用者感受不到其中的差异。并且根据读者在正常阅读纸质书籍的行为习惯,将此行为习惯移植到移动终端设备的体验上,尽可能做到在移动终端设备上阅读与纸质书籍阅读的用户体验一致。
需解决的主要技术难题
采用Android中适配器的方式使得数据能够在各种View(ListView、GridView 等)中进行显示,启用通讯接口模块使得系统能够方便的与网络服务器进行通信,数据实体模块使得系统从服务器端获取到的数据能够让程序直接使用,共用工具包模块则包含了系统其他模块中所需要的常用工具。
基于MuPDF和FBReader两大开源内核实现,从内核的选取经过了广泛的选取和细致的筛选,最终根据综合性能确定最终内核的使用。根据内核代码的异同,进行了求同存异的代码提取和功能融合,在结合现有的软件流程和模块的划分,添加了除内核外的业务逻辑等上层代码。最终实现了两大内核并存的状态,实现多格式的支持。
本系统为用户特别是Android用户提供一个方便快捷的获取当下小学生经典文章的功能,包括文章精选、文章阅读、分享以及订阅和系统更新功能。
期望实现的主要技术目标
基于Android 平台的电子书阅读软件进行了详细分析,论证了软件实施的可行性。根据软件的要求选择了软件以MVC 的体系架构,通过系统的兼容性测试和对系统的适用性评估,说明了系统的适应性和实用性。
处理进度